Institutionele geschiedenis
The Royal Canadian Legion undertook a project in 1984 to commemorate its Diamond Jubilee. The project involved interviewing Legionnaires from 245 Branches of the Royal Canadian Legion across Canada.
Geschiedenis beheer
Bereik en inhoud
Collection contains 29 audio cassette copies and 4 video cassette copies of interviews with Newfoundland members of the Royal Canadian Legion, along with 6 photographs and a photocopy of a diary. The interviews contain information about the personal background, war experience, career accomplishments and Legion activities of 21 individuals from 9 branches of the Legion in Newfoundland: Cluny Brenson, Irene Chaulk, George Babstock, Melvin Dawe, Earl Jewison, Alfred Warren, George Dyke, Howard Mckay, Berkley Evans, Richard Rideout, Albert Garnier, Fred Knight, Hubert Myles, Lillian Elliot, Wilhelmina Caines, George Chalker, Edward Rusted, Walter Williams, Cyril Pelley, Mary Pelley, Ronald O'Keefe. Copies of all these interviews, along with the forms, indexes, transcripts and memorabilia donated by the informants were made and delivered to MUNFLA in 1987.
